1- Trump Signals Exit from Iran War Soon
President Trump indicates U.S. objectives are nearly achieved and suggests a possible drawdown of the Iran war, though he has not agreed to a ceasefire.
2- Iran’s Missile 4000 km Reach Raises Concern
A failed strike on Diego Garcia suggests Iran may now possess long-range missile capability far beyond its earlier declared limits.
3- USA Decides to Lift Sanction on Iranian Oil
The U.S. has issued a 30-day waiver allowing sale of about 140 million barrels of Iranian oil already at sea to ease rising global prices.
4- Iran Declares It Is Near Victory
In a Nowruz message, Supreme Leader Mojtaba Khamenei claimed the “enemy has been defeated,” projecting strength despite ongoing conflict.

5. Govt Increases Commercial LPG Allocation
The government on Saturday approved an additional 20% allocation of commercial LPG to states and UTs, taking the total allocation to 50%, including 10% linked to PNG expansion reforms.
6. ‘Prakriti 2026’ Conference on Carbon Markets Begins
The Centre launched the International Conference on Carbon Markets—Prakriti 2026—bringing together policymakers, industry leaders and global experts to discuss climate action.
